Wednesday, July 30 to Friday August 1, 12:30 to 2:30 pm
Ages-14+
Give your old jeans new life! In this creative summer class, teens will learn how to transform worn or outdated denim into a beach bag. Just in time for the beach! This class blends fashion, sustainability, and hands-on sewing skills.
We'll explore the art of upstyling-turning existing garments into fresh, wearable designs that reflect your unique style while helping reduce textile waste. No fashion experience necessary-just bring your imagination, your old denim, and get ready to stitch something amazing.
Skills Covered:
Denim deconstruction techniques Pattern remixing & basic alterations Hand & machine sewing Design planning for sustainable fashion Bring 1-2 pairs of old jeans (any size or style)
Hands- on instruction and sewing machines will be provided. (You may bring your own sewing machine to use if you have one.)
